源码怎么放到web服务器上面,深入解析,如何将源码部署到Web服务器上
- 综合资讯
- 2024-11-26 19:07:02
- 2

将源码部署到Web服务器,首先需将代码打包成可部署格式,如war或jar文件。通过FTP、SCP等工具将文件上传至服务器。配置Web服务器(如Apache或Nginx)...
将源码部署到Web服务器,首先需将代码打包成可部署格式,如war或jar文件。通过FTP、SCP等工具将文件上传至服务器。配置Web服务器(如Apache或Nginx),设置虚拟主机,并映射到部署目录。重启服务器以应用配置,确保源码正确部署并运行。
随着互联网技术的不断发展,越来越多的企业开始将业务迁移到线上,而Web服务器作为承载网站、应用程序的基石,其稳定性和安全性至关重要,将源码部署到Web服务器上,是每一个开发者都需要掌握的基本技能,本文将详细解析如何将源码部署到Web服务器上,包括准备工作、配置环境、上传源码、配置服务器等步骤。
准备工作
1、确定服务器类型:根据业务需求,选择合适的Web服务器类型,如Apache、Nginx、IIS等。
2、购买或搭建服务器:可以选择购买云服务器,或者自己搭建服务器,购买云服务器时,注意选择合适的配置和带宽。
3、获取服务器IP地址和SSH密钥:通过云服务器提供商或者服务器管理界面获取服务器的公网IP地址和SSH密钥。
4、安装SSH客户端:在本地电脑上安装SSH客户端,如PuTTY、Xshell等。
配置环境
1、安装Web服务器:在服务器上安装所选的Web服务器,如Apache、Nginx等。
2、配置Web服务器:根据实际需求,配置Web服务器的相关参数,如监听端口、虚拟主机等。
3、安装PHP环境(如有需要):对于PHP应用程序,需要安装PHP环境,在服务器上安装PHP,并配置相关参数。
4、安装数据库(如有需要):对于需要数据库支持的应用程序,需要安装数据库服务器,如MySQL、MariaDB等。
上传源码
1、使用SSH连接服务器:使用SSH客户端连接到服务器,输入服务器IP地址和SSH密钥。
2、创建项目目录:在服务器上创建项目目录,用于存放源码。
3、上传源码:使用SSH客户端的文件传输功能,将本地源码上传到服务器项目目录。
4、解压源码:在服务器上解压上传的源码文件。
配置服务器
1、配置Web服务器:根据实际需求,配置Web服务器的相关参数,如虚拟主机、文档根目录等。
2、配置数据库(如有需要):配置数据库用户、密码、数据库名等参数。
3、配置PHP环境(如有需要):配置PHP的扩展模块、配置文件等。
4、配置应用程序:根据应用程序的需求,配置相关参数,如配置文件、环境变量等。
测试和调试
1、测试应用程序:在服务器上测试应用程序的功能,确保应用程序运行正常。
2、调试问题:在测试过程中,如遇到问题,根据日志、错误信息等进行调试。
3、优化性能:对应用程序进行性能优化,提高运行效率。
将源码部署到Web服务器上,是每一个开发者都需要掌握的基本技能,本文详细解析了如何将源码部署到Web服务器上,包括准备工作、配置环境、上传源码、配置服务器、测试和调试等步骤,通过学习和实践,相信读者能够熟练掌握这一技能,为后续的开发工作奠定基础。
本文链接:https://zhitaoyun.cn/1102432.html
发表评论